Its a NO2 product. Nitric oxide. Yeah, basically it pumps you up for a workout... In my opinion, its just an overpriced alternative to caffiene, but some people swear by it.
Bomba 07-15-2007, 10:49 PM contains 100mg caffiene per scoop, 1g creatine ethyl ester per scoop, not sure how much argine per scoop and a of b12. it gives alot of energy and increased circulation but it isnt the greatest thing for u.

mainly it makes your heart work harder, vasodilators + caffiene. definatly has way more punch than a redbull / expresso.
